Sep 21, 2021 · Schizophrenic disorders are a group of severe mental diseases that have an estimated annual incidence of 15.2 per 100,000 patients, though the exact prevalence can oscillate between 3.3‰ and 7.2‰ [1]. Schizophrenia is mainly considered a chronic disorder that may follow several patterns that partly define the illness prognosis.

Myth: The majority of service members who die by suicide had a mental illness. Fact: Less than half of service members who died by suicide had a mental health diagnosis. Myth: Suicidal behavior is hereditary. Fact: Suicide may occur more often in some families but suicidal behavior is not genetic.
